O R D E R

This Writ Petition has been filed seeking a Writ of Certiorarified Mandamus, to call for the records on the file of the second respondent in connection with the impugned order of rejection passed by him in Na.Ka. No.01/Va.Ka.Va./2023, dated 05.01.2023 and quash the same as illegal and arbitrary and consequently, directing the respondents to grant permission and necessary protection to perform the cultural programme with public Addressing System (Radio Sound System) (i.e,) Children Sports event, Knowledge test, and etc., in the event of Christmas and New Year function at Christianpettai North Street, W. Puthupatti Village, Watrap Taluk, Virudhunagar District based on the petitioner's representation, dated 03.01.2023 submitted to the second respondent in person.

2. Mr.E.Antony Sahaya Prabahar, learned Additional Public Prosecutor takes notice for the respondents. By consent, this writ petition is taken up for final disposal at the admission stage itself.

3. The learned Additional Public Prosecutor appearing for the respondents would submit that the second respondent had already issued proceedings dated 05.01.2023, granting permission, but imposing certain conditions; that they should not use the speakers. He would further submit that the petitioner may be permitted to conduct the programme on 15.01.2023 and 16.01.2023 with certain conditions that may be imposed by this Court.

4. At this juncture, the learned counsel appearing for the writ petitioner would submit that they are ready to conduct the programme as stated by the learned Additional Public Prosecutor. He would further submit that they are only conducting the cultural programme for the students and they have to announce the names and the nature of the programmes through the speakers.

5. I have considered the submission of the learned counsel appearing for the writ petitioner and the learned Additional Public Prosecutor appearing for the respondents.

6. It is brought to the notice of this Court that the Director General of Police, Tamil Nadu, Chennai had issued a circular memorandum in Rc.007301/Genl.I (1)/2019, dated 09.04.2019, along with instructions to the Inspectors of Police throughout Tamil Nadu for consideration of applications seeking permission for conducting cultural programme. Therefore, in view of the detailed circular and guidelines issued by the Director General of Police, the writ petitioner is directed to file a fresh representation and on such representation, the second respondent is directed to consider the representation of the petitioner and pass orders imposing necessary conditions along with following conditions : " (i) Songs should not be played touching upon the political party or religion or community or caste.

(ii) The function should not affect either religion or communual harmony and shall be conducted without any discremination based on caste."

7. With the above direction, this writ petition stands disposed of. No costs.
